I can't believe how relatively short-lived this one-of-a-kind series was compared to most of Nickelodeon's contrived and un-enthralling entries like As Told by Ginger and The Wild Thornberrys. This show was the greatest slapstick, tongue-in-cheek extravagganza since the Marx Brothers and Three Stooges in their heyday. Some critics brand this eternal gem about a high-strung chihuahua and his hair-brained feline pal as juvenile, moronic, and violent, but if you think about it, so were Bugs Bunny cartoons. That's why they're funny! And why they've endeared themselves to our public conscience in such an indellible fashion. And let me say something else. Ren & Stimpy premiered when I was seven years old (I'm nineteen now), and I can say with undeniable certainty that THIS program is directly responsible for my lifelong love-affair with classical music. What other program has made such breathtaking and directly visual use of Dvorak's New World Symphony, or Tchaikovsky's Romeo & Juliet Fantasy Overture? In fact, if you listen carefully, throughout the course of one single episode, a different, great cue of classical music is played almost every five seconds! Can we forget how they used the Andante movement from Mozart's 21st Piano Concerto in the bathtub scene of Space Madness? I think not! Anyway, just some food for thought. And when is this show going to be brought to us on DVD? Thanks, and keep watching!

It is not that often where a cartoon can have some zany humor, with a hint of originality, and a great duo of characters. In the case of Nickelodeon, they had that edge when Ren & Stimpy was introduced to the public. In 1991, Ren & Stimpy became one of the most dynamic duos of our time. The laugh out loud humor and a dash of hairballs and liter, makes them that true.

The 1993 video, The Classics, consists of only three Ren & Stimpy cartoons to the taking: Untamed World, Space Madness, and Stimpy's Invention. In Untamed World, the dog and manx cat duo, showcase a parody of one of the most boring issues in the world, nature shows. With a lot of humor and excitement from evolution pasrodies of Ren & Stimpy, like the Soft Shell Stimpy, and the Horny-billed Chihuahua.

In Space Madness, Ren & Stimpy are in outer space, trying to control Ren's temper, from losing contol from boredom of being in space too long. The mix of humor blends in quite smoothly, as Ren eats a bar of soap, thinking it is an ice cream bar, while also trying to control Stimpy's madness, from pushing a button that will erase all of history.

In Stimpy's Invention, Stimpy wants Ren to volunteer to try out some weird inventions, like stay-put socks, and a remote controlled shaver. Ironically, it isn't until the happy helmet, where Ren is controlled into being happy for life, by Stimpy. At the same time, Ren destroys the hat whle doing the Happy Happy, Joy Joy dance.

It is just a shame that Nickelodeon stopped broadcasting Ren & Stimpy. It is just kind of sad. When the laughter dies, the duo dies as well. It is also sad the a lot of video stores stopped carrying videos from the duo. If you really want to laugh out loud in crazyness, then introduce yourselves to Ren & Stimpy.
